강의

멘토링

커뮤니티

인프런 커뮤니티 질문&답변

김민석님의 프로필 이미지
김민석

작성한 질문수

스프링 시큐리티

404 error page로 이동하는 것에 대해

작성

·

333

0

http.authorizeRequests()
.mvcMatchers("/","/login*").permitAll()
.anyRequest().authenticated();

위의 경로를 제외하고는 인증을 받아야만 페이지 이동이 가능하다고 해놓아서 그런지 이상한 경로를 입력했을 경우에도 로그인하라고 창이 뜹니다. 저는 404error에 대한 처리를 해놓아서 바로 그 페이지로 이동하게 하고 싶은데, 로그인을 하면 정상적으로 작동되지만 로그인을 하지 않은 경우에는 로그인 창으로 이동합니다.

허가하는 경로에 모든 경로를 적어줄순 없는데 어떻게 해결해야하나요??

답변 1

0

정수원님의 프로필 이미지
정수원
지식공유자

제가 위 코드만 복사해서 실행 했을 경우에는 로그인 창이 뜨지 않습니다.

정확한 테스트를 위해  git 공유 해 주시면 확인해 보도록 하겠습니다.

김민석님의 프로필 이미지
김민석
질문자

다른코드에서 문제가 있었습니다. 문제 발견하고 해결하였습니다!

김민석님의 프로필 이미지
김민석

작성한 질문수

질문하기